// BILLING_DRAIN_TIMEOUT_SECONDS
//
// Controls how long the Tollgrove billing worker drains in-flight
// invoices before a blue-green cutover completes. Set to 90s after the
// March incident where a 30s drain truncated batch settlements mid-write.
// Both colors run this value; changing it requires coordinated redeploy
// of green first. The deploy that established this baseline is traced below.

session token of kageg-tahop = htk14_af3c1ccccb7dcf

## Gross-Margin Review — Managers Only

This page summarises the half-year gross-margin review for the board. Margins on the Corvale product family slipped 2.3 points, mainly from freight and packaging costs. The Ashgrove line held steady. Mitigations in progress: renegotiated carrier rates and a packaging redesign due next quarter. Divisional breakdowns are linked on the finance hub. The confidential note on forward plans appears below.

confidential, fahag-yahap: Project Raleth slips by six weeks because of the tooling delay.

**Mgmt Meeting Minutes — Retiring the Brightline Range**

Quick recap for sales leads at Fenholt Supplies: we agreed to retire the Brightline fixture range by year-end. Remaining stock moves to clearance pricing next month, and accounts on standing orders get migrated to the Lumetta range. Trade-in incentives were approved in principle. The confidential note on next steps sits just below.

board note of bajof-bajeg: The pricing group signed off on a budget of $13.4 million for Project Sildor. The renewal with Lamixek Holdings closes at $48.9 million a year, 49 percent above the last contract.

Facilities Ticket — Cleaning Crew Access, Brindle Annex

For new starters handling evening lock-up: the Sorano Cleaning crew arrives nightly at 21:30 via the annex side door. Check their rota sheet, note arrival in the log, and ensure the storeroom is relocked afterward. To let them through the side door, enter the access code below.

badge for yaweg-hafog: bdg-GX-6